CVE-2018-12037

CVE-2018-12037 affects self-encrypting drives (TCG Opal/ATA‑based) where there is no cryptographic binding between the user password and the Disk Encryption Key, enabling full data access by someone with privileged access to the drive controller in ATA High mode. CVE-2018-12038

CVE-2018-12038 is a hardware-encryption vulnerability affecting self-encrypting drives (e.g., Samsung 840 EVO, MX100/MX200/MX300, Samsung T3/T5) where wear-leveling and weak binding between the user password and the disk-encryption key can allow an attacker with physical access to recover data.
